• ベストアンサー

パソコンのメモリアドレスとバンクの関係について

パソコンでたとえば1Gのメモリが実装されていればアドレスは 0x00000000~0x3fffffffでそれぞれに72ビットデータが 割り付けられると思います。 そのときバンクとアドレスの関係がよくわかりません どなたか教えていただけないで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
  • Tasuke22
  • ベストアンサー率33% (1799/5383)
回答No.1

一般的には気にしないこと柄だと思いますが。 PCの場合、メモリバンクはメモリセル(LSI単位) だと思います。 1GBでメモリセルが8個なら128MB。16個なら64MBで はないでしょうか。 実際にアクセスはセル単位に行いメモリバンクの 概念と同じような振る舞いを行うようです。

C_is_Best
質問者

補足

回答ありがとうございます もう少し踏み込んだ質問ですが たとえば1GBでメモリセルが8個なら アドレスとバンクの関係は  0x00000000~0x07ffffff BANK0 0x08000000~0x0fffffff BANK1 0x10000000~0x17ffffff BANK2 | | ↓ 0x28000000~0x3fffffff BANK7 こんな割付とおもえばいいでしょうか?

その他の回答 (1)

  • Tasuke22
  • ベストアンサー率33% (1799/5383)
回答No.2

いえ分かりません。 複数枚のメモリやメモリセルの違うメモリの 混在などの場合、どうなっているのか分かり ません。 直感的には、先頭から順番にアドレスを付けて いるように思えますし、複数枚の時には、スロッ ト番号のゲタをはかせているだけのように思い ます。 サイズの異なるメモリを複数枚刺すとアドレスの 空白など出来るのかどうか・・・わかりません。

C_is_Best
質問者

お礼

ありがとうございます メモリコントローラー系のドキュメントからもそのような 記述を見つけることができました。 明確な仕様を出している資料はすくないみたいです

関連するQ&A

  • メモリバンク数??

    パソコンの改造は初めての者です。 メモリ増設に伴い、メモリバンク数という項目を確認する次第です。 私のパソコンはsis651チップセットだということが分かっています。 しかし、sis651のバンク数が分かりません。 どなたかご存知の方おりませんでしょうか? sis651↓ http://www.sis.com/products/sis651.htm また、 http://oshiete1.goo.ne.jp/qa2505586.html にて、片面実装は非対応とおっしゃられておりますが、それを何処で確認したらよいのか分かりません。先に示したsis651のページに書かれているのですか?英語がまったく苦手で何処に書いてあるのか分かりませんでした(涙 何卒よろしくお願いいたします。

  • PC133 512MBで1バンクのメモリ

    今頃になって、「DIMM 168pin SDRAM PC133 512MB CL3」のメモリが必要になりました。 ただ、片面もしくは両面実装でも1バンクでなければならないのですが、両面実装で1バンクのメモリをどのように見分けたらいいか分かりません。 この場合、やはり店員に確認する以外ないのでしょうか? なお、手っ取り早く、両面で1バンクの512MBメモリを発売しているメーカー名と型番、バルクであればショップ名を教えていただければありがたく思います。 それでは、ご存知の方がいらっしゃいましたらよろしくお願いいたします。

  • メモリの増設 バンク数って?

    メモリ増設したいんですけど、自分なりに調べてみると、チップセットにはバンク制限が有る場合があるとかで、これがよく分かりません。 メモリスロットの数のことでしょうか? メモリスロットは2しかないので、両面実装だと、認識されないんでしょうか? 詳しい人がいたら、よろしくおねがいします。 ソーテック PC STATION G380DW グラフィックシステム intel815 メモリカード PC133 ECCなし 256MBを買おおと、思っています。

  • 自作パソコン メモリ

    はじめまして  一週間前に自作パソコンを作ったのですが 実装メモリは8Gなのに使用可能は2.9Gなんですけど2枚のメモリのうちどちらか壊れているか問題があると考えていいのでしょうか?

  • メモリ・最大バンク数

    今メモリ増設について調べてます 僕のパソコンはメーカー公表だと増設の最大値が256Mです でも某サイトで調べたところ最大バンク数という言葉を見つけて読んでいたのですがいまいちよく分かりませんでした 僕なりに解釈したのは僕のパソコンは2Gまで増設できるんじゃないかってことでした でも三菱電機やBUFFALOやIO-DATAなどのサイトを見ると最大256になってました 最大バンク数とはなんですか? あと僕のパソコンにはいくつまで増設できるんでしょうか 分かる方いたら教えてください 僕のパソコンは三菱電機・apricot AL320 M3N33-Y27AMです 元々はOSが98SEですが2000が入ってます よろしくお願いします

  • メモリのbankの数で速度は変わるのでしょうか?

    メモリを買おうと思って調べていたら、デュアルチャンネル対応の2枚セットのメモリの説明に、 「2枚で2バンクなのでAthlon64用に最適」 と書かれているのですが、 Athlon X2でも1bank*2の効果はあるのでしょうか? あるならばどれくらいの効果があるのでしょうか? ご教授おねがいします。

  • パソコンのアドレスは何ビットですか?

    聞くのも恥ずかしいのですが・・・・ パソコンのアドレスは何ビットですか? Z80ならば、確かアドレス16ビットで、データ8ビットと習った記憶があります。それと比較するとどのように考えたらよいのでしょうか

  • 実装メモリ・非実装メモリとは?

    http://www.tij.co.jp/lsds/ti_ja/general/mcu_basics/mcu05_memory.page ↑のページの図2のメモリのアドレスの図に 実装メモリ 非実装メモリ と書かれてあるんですが、これはどういう意味なんでしょうか? つまりこれは 実装メモリ→命令・データを自由に入れられる領域 非実装メモリ→命令・データを入れられない(すでに命令・データが内蔵されている)領域 ということでしょうか? わかりやすく説明してください。よろしくお願いします。

  • デスクトップパソコンのメモリについて

    オークションで落札した「HP Pavilion s5730jp/CT」のメモリについて質問します。 メモリの増設をと思いケースを空けてみたところマザーボードのメモリスロットに以下のようにメモリが挿さっていました。 メモリスロット1(青)SILICON POWERの2G(PC3-10600 1333MHz DDR3 SDRAM)片面実装 メモリスロット2(青)なし メモリスロット3(黒)HPのシールが付いたMicronの1GB(PC3-10600 1333MHz DDR3 SDRAM)片面実装 メモリスロット4(黒)HPのシールが付いたMicronの1GB(PC3-10600 1333MHz DDR3 SDRAM)片面実装 OSはWindows7 Home Premium64bitです。 質問1 このメモリの挿し方は正しいのでしょうか? 質問2 この3枚のメモリとは別にCFDのPC3-10600 1333MHz DDR3 SDRAM 両面実装 4Gが2枚あります。 この5枚のメモリを一番理想的に使う場合の挿し方はどのようにしたら良いのでしょうか? ちなみにマザーボードは「H-ALVORIX-RS880-uATX」という物です。

  • 最大物理メモリサイズにGPUは含まれますか?

    最大物理メモリサイズにGPUメモリは含まれますか? Windows 7 Home Premium x64(64bit)を使用しているのですが GPUメモリを4Gとメインメモリくを8G積んでいるのですが、 メインメモリをついかしようかと考えた時に 追加できるのが 4Gなのか8Gなのかわからなくなってしまい質問させていただきました。 Windowsのコントロールパネル上では実装メモリ(RAM):8.00GBとなっているので 8G追加できる気がするのですが メインメモリはなかなか高いので…